Description
- The stylish and durable 'Nylon Canvas Computer Field Bag II' from Jack Spade™ is sure to become an instant favorite.
- Made of nylon canvas.
- Holds your personal technology, a magazine and file folders.
- Single adjustable cross body strap. Cross body drop: 26" length.
- Front exterior zip pockets and rear exterior slip pocket.
- Top flap with a hook-and-loop closure.
- Interior lining with a zip pocket and multifunctional organizing pockets.
- Dimensions: 14 1/2" wide x 5 1/2" deep x 11 1/2" high.
- Measurements:
- Bottom Width: 14 1⁄2 in
- Depth: 5 1⁄2 in
- Height: 11 1⁄4 in
- Strap Length: 59 in
- Strap Drop: 26 in
- Weight: 2 lbs 3 oz
- Please note, the hardware color and interior lining may differ from the color shown in the photo.

In 2009, Jack Spade bags and wallets built on their reputation for quality and function by adding Jack Spade clothing to its arsenal. Beginning with high quality polo shirts, Jack Spade clothing now offers sweaters, coats, parkas, hoodies, pants and shorts.
Jack Spade studies what people wear and carry in their vocations; photographers and masons, land surveyors and architects, carpenters and writers. From these observations, Jack Spade designs bags, wallets and clothing that offer functionality, age well and retain a sense of style.

Bought one of these to replace an older Jack Spade bag. My last one lasted years. On this one, the lining lasted weeks before splitting everywhere. Looks junky now. Contacted Jack Spade about it. They told me to send it in as it qualifies for a "repair". the said it would take a month. I am to send it to them on my dime. During which time I guess they expect me to carry my goods in a shopping bag. Lame response form a big company. I sent photos...you can see the damage. How about, send me a new bag and I'll send you the damaged one. I turned down their offer and never heard back. I am embarrassed for them.

I bought this bag for my husband's birthday. He wanted a bag that he could use for work, but wasn't leather. It fits a 1.5 inch binder (or his 14 inch laptop) plus an umbrella no problem. It’s simple but stylish. We recommend it!

This is a nice bag. I'm a woman, and it works well for me; looks stylish and not too masculine, but on a man it would look masculine and not feminine. The only things that make it a bit less useful for me are the velcro, which some folks will like. For me, I dislike the loud velcro noise every time I hope the bag, and the toothy velcro pieces have a tendency to snag my clothes. Also the bag is a bit on the small size for all the small, yet heavy side. But it's still quite useful. I've carried a 13" Macbook, as well as an iPad and bluetooth keyboard along with passport, wallet, glasses cases, etc. all comfortable and without a fat bulging bag. Not perfect but overall stylish, useful and pretty good value.
